Latest News

How to Choose the Best EA Trading Software for Your Forex Strategy

Expert Advisors (EAs) have exploded in popularity among active forex traders in recent years. Also referred to as trading robots or automated trading programs, EAs enable setting detailed technical rules for identifying trades which are then automatically executed in your account.

However, with hundreds of options now available, picking the right one aligned to your strategy presents a challenge. In this article, we will discuss the key considerations to keep in mind while selecting a specific software!

EA Trading Software – Things to Consider

By considering the key factors below, you can effectively evaluate compatibility to discover your best-matched EA:

1. Understand Types of Strategies

Gaining clarity on your specific forex strategy type guides appropriate EA selection. The most common strategy categories include:

  • Trend Following – Identifies strong upward or downward price momentum to ride established trends.
  • Mean Reversion – Trades counter to price extremes expecting reversion to long-term means.
  • Scalping – Rapid trades focused on high volume for small but very frequent profit targets.
  • News/Event Based – Trades triggered by scheduled events like central bank decisions or GDP.

Match EA tools to your primary strategy. For example, trend followers prioritize dynamic averages while mean reversion EAs emphasize oscillators like RSI more heavily.

2. Analyze Performance History

The proven historical track record of any EA trading bot remains the ultimate credibility indicator. Backtesting over 5+ years demonstrating consistent simulated returns through varied market cycles carries more weight than flashy marketing claims when evaluating options.

3. Compare Program Languages

EAs are programmed using either the simple drag & drop MetaQuotes Language 4 (MQL4) or the more advanced MetaQuotes Language 5 (MQL5) built into MetaTrader. If pursuing complex strategies, prioritize MQL5. Check language before purchasing.

4. Test Timeframe Alignment

An essential yet often overlooked factor is ensuring the EA’s hardcoded intervals for indicators match your preferred timeframes for trading and analysis whether 1 minute, daily, weekly or others.

5. Customization Capabilities

Even among the same strategy type, adjustable inputs regulating aspects like trade timing, sizing, risk limits, position management and trigger rules enable personalization to your trading plan. Seek EAs enabling extensive customization.

Optimizing Your Selected EA

While identifying an EA matching desired strategy elements and customization abilities is step one, dedicating effort to optimizing configurations unlocks the full potential.

1. Historical Backtesting

Most EAs enable running extensive backtests against years of historical data to simulate how automated trades would have performed. Tweak settings like trade frequency, indicators used, profit targets, etc while reviewing key performance metrics after each test. Determine optimal configurations for live trading.

2. Forward Testing

In addition to backtests, forward test your EA in real-time connected to a demo account for at least one month. Assess functionality across breaking news events, earnings reports, and speeches to confirm resilient performance.

3. Risk Management Guardrails

Conservatively configure built-in risk management settings like maximum drawdown rules before launching to prevent exceeding loss tolerances even during abnormal volatility periods.

4. Ongoing Performance Reviews

Schedule periodic comparisons of actual trading statistics vs backtested expectations to detect deviations signaling needed adjustments. Capture learnings to further refine configurations for improved automated execution.

Conclusion

As Expert Advisors transform how active traders build and execute forex strategies, selecting the best-fit EA grows increasingly crucial. By mapping coded logic and custom inputs to your preferred analysis timeframes, trade execution tactics, risk parameters and strategy rules, traders can unlock an automated edge previously inaccessible. While evaluating performance track records and alignment takes diligence on the front-end, once up and running, EAs enable hands-free access to opportunities around the clock. If willing to invest in identifying and optimizing the right EA match, achieving streamlined execution of proven crypto and forex tactics awaits.